As families throughout the Bay Area celebrate the Lunar New Year holiday many within the Asian American community are also getting organized in response to a series of recent attacks. On this edition of KCBS In Depth we speak with a few of the leading advocates about what solutions they’re pushing towards.

Then later in the program we speak with a local healthcare leader in San Francisco's Chinatown about how the neighborhood managed to defy early expectations and keep infection rates among the lowest in the city. 

Guest: 

Russell Jeung, professor of Asian American Studies, San Francisco State University |  co-founder, Stop AAPI Hate

Cynthia Choi, co-executive director, Chinese for Affirmative Action | co-founder, stop AAPI Hate 

Dr. Jian Zhang, chief executive officer, Chinese Hospital in San Francisco
